About Larry

Hello everyone,
I was born and raised in Northern California. I am a combat vet from the Vietnam era. I served as a Navy Corpsman and was attached to the 1st Marine Division 1st Marines from Camp Pendleton, California. The photo shows me receiving a Purple Heart and Silver Star for helping wounded Marines caught in an ambush attack. I was seriously wounded myself. I returned to college and graduated from California State University Long Beach. I started my career in the Advertising Agency field in Los Angeles. I moved to New York City and became an Outplacement executive with a large International firm. I decided not to retire and instead launched my own Home Improvement company servicing customer in the Connecticut and New York area. Additionally, I earned various credentials to sharpen my skills as a Transition Coach to help people making life changing career transitions.

Every time I visit the VA hospital near me I am reminded of my strong interest to help veterans any way I can. This online forum is a brilliant idea and I plan to contribute as much as I can to help those making a transition back to civilian life. I've been through that and with my training as a career professional and transition coach, I feel especially qualified to offer meaningful support to anyone who requests it.

I offer my salute to all veterans for continuing to keep America safe and for taking advantage of this opportunity to get support.
